Denver — Gart Properties has received $42 million in financing for a four-property retail portfolio in Colorado that totals 436,107 square feet. The centers include Pavilion Shopping Center in Fort Collins, Indian Tree Shopping Center in Arvada, Micro Center Shopping Center in Denver, and Saddle Rock Village in Aurora. The portfolio was 94 percent occupied by anchors such as Michaels, T.J. Maxx, Sprouts and PetSmart.

The proceeds were used to refinance maturing debt on the centers and to also allow Gart Properties to realize the value that had been created through renovation and repositioning of the assets. The 10-year loan carries a fixed rate of 4.5 percent. Eric Tupler, Josh Simon and Kristian Lichtenfels with HFF arranged the financing through a correspondent life company lender.

Denver-based Gart Properties has a portfolio of more than 3.5 million square feet of shopping center space.
